Verdict: Bose SoundLink Flex 2 wins for most users with clearer mids and highs (CNET 2025 review) and refined build, while JBL Charge 6 excels in raw output and 30-hour runtime (JBL official specs). The Bose on sound quality by a noticeable margin in blind tests versus the bass-forward JBL. Choose JBL if maximum volume and battery matter most.
